In 2005, post-hardcore band Hawthorne Heights alluded to the phrase in the title of their single "Ohio Is for Lovers", which would become widely regarded as an anthem of the early 2000’s emo music scene.

[6] American Idol winner Jordin Sparks recorded a song called "Virginia is for Lovers" in 2007, which was featured as a bonus track on her self-titled debut album.

The slogan is also mentioned in the Fountains of Wayne song "I-95", from their 2007 album Traffic and Weather, singing "They've got most of / the Barney DVDs / and coffee mugs and tees / that say Virginia is for lovers, but it's not.
